Roya: Though I was expelled from Baku State University on November 22, 2006, I was reinstated a month later

Chief of teaching department of Baku State University Ibad Ibadov told APA that Roya was expelled from the university on November 22, 2006, because she did not passed the exams and missed the sessions.
Lawyer of Baku State University Tofig Sadigov said at the preliminary court hearing on the lawsuit filed by correspondent of Bizim yol newspaper Natig Gulahmadoglu against Baku State University that Roya (Najafova Royala Yagub) was expelled from the university. Tofig Sadigov said Roya could not pass the exams of the winter session of 2005-2006 academic year and missed the summer session and was expelled from Baku State University under rector Abel Maharramov’s order dating to 22.11.2006.
On December 5, 2007 the singer told APA exclusively that she was transferred to Baku State University from Moscow State University.
“I entered Moscow State University legally, studied there for a year. As from the second year I have been continuing my education in Baku State University. The reports that I was admitted to Baku State University illegally are groundless. I am studying by correspondence,†she said.
On February 20, Abel Maharramov told journalists that Roya had studied economics and was getting her second education in the faculty of law.
“Her admission to Baku State University is not illegal, the singer it getting the second education in the faculty of law of Baku State University and admission to the university to get the second education is possible through internal test. Roya has the certificate of higher education and she was admitted to the university basing on this certificate. There is a competition, if the applicants are more than the vacancies,†he said.
